For branch managers: following sustained volatility in the thaler–crown exchange rate affecting our Velstrand imports, the finance committee has approved forward contracts covering seventy percent of projected purchases for the next four quarters. This limits upside gains but protects margins on the Harvest Crate range. Branches should hold retail pricing steady and route any supplier surcharge queries to regional finance. Please read this alongside the strategic context, which is recorded below for completeness.

internal memo for faweg-tafog: Only 7 of the 100 pilot accounts renewed Quenael, so a churn review is set for April 15.

## Authentication

Welcome to Driftpane, our diff viewer for oversized files. The viewer itself is stateless, but fetching chunked diffs from the Driftpane blob service requires a bearer token on every request. Tokens are minted per environment and expire weekly; new hires should always start with the dev-environment token rather than staging. Never commit tokens to the repo. For your first local run, use the following:

session JWT of yawep-yawep = eyJhbGciOiJIUzI1NiIsInR5cCI6IkpXVCJ9.eyJzdWIiOiI3pWF3_In0.aXYsHiog

## Quota Service Recovery (for Thursday's sync)

Quick recap: if a tenant on Pellgrove gets locked out after tripping their per-tenant rate quota, don't just bump the limit — that masks the real problem. Reset their quota window from the admin shell, check whether their burst pattern looks legit, and then re-enable the account. The shell's recovery mode is gated, as always, so keep it handy: it will ask for the passphrase listed below.

unlock words, fafop-hawep: briwyn-oliix-sorox